Breaking Free from Arrogance: Embracing Authenticity and Connection

Look around you. In today’s world, ambition and self-promotion dominate our surroundings. We often find ourselves relentlessly chasing success, believing that arrogance and ego will drive us forward. But what if I told you that true greatness lies on a different path, one marked by humility and self-awareness?

Think about a place where people go beyond being too proud of themselves. Instead, they embrace the idea that being humble can change their lives for the better. In this special place, you’ll find stories of people becoming better and making strong connections with others. It’s a place where even though people don’t talk about it much, their kindness and understanding can make a big difference in the world we all share.

Dear fellow travellers on this journey called life, let’s explore the extraordinary power of releasing arrogance and embracing humility. Let’s dive into inspiring stories and examples that illuminate the incredible transformations that occur when we shed our ego, opening ourselves to the beauty of human connection and personal growth.

  1. The Tale of the Lone Wolf: In the quest for dominance, the arrogant lone wolf may soar momentarily, basking in the spotlight of individual achievement. Yet, isolated and unyielding, they miss the vibrant tapestry of collaboration and support that could have propelled them even further. It is through humility and openness that true greatness is achieved, as we learn to value the contributions and perspectives of others.
  2. The Fall of the Ivory Tower: Behold the mighty fortress of ego, built upon the foundation of superiority. But as the winds of change blow and new ideas emerge, the rigid walls crumble, leaving behind a hollow echo of lost opportunities. In contrast, those who embrace humility and curiosity find themselves at the forefront of innovation, adaptable and open to constant growth.
  3. The Price of Broken Relationships: Arrogance and ego act as corrosive forces, eroding the bonds that hold us together. They blind us to the needs and feelings of others, leaving a trail of broken relationships and shattered trust. By cultivating empathy and genuine connection, we create a nurturing environment where collaboration and understanding thrive, leading to profound personal and collective growth.
  4. The Liberation of Vulnerability: Within the fortress of ego, vulnerability is shunned, seen as a sign of weakness. However, it is through vulnerability that true strength is found. By acknowledging our limitations and embracing humility, we invite growth and transformation into our lives. It is in our moments of vulnerability that we connect with others on a profound level, forming bonds that withstand the test of time.
  5. The Empty Throne: Imagine a leader consumed by their own ego, wielding power with an iron fist. While they may command authority in the short term, their reign is characterized by fear, resentment, and a lack of genuine loyalty. In contrast, leaders who practice humility and empathy inspire loyalty, foster a collaborative environment, and build lasting legacies.
  6. The Mask of Infallibility: Arrogance and ego often lead individuals to believe they are infallible, incapable of making mistakes. This facade of perfection isolates them from valuable feedback and growth opportunities. By embracing humility and recognizing our fallibility, we open ourselves up to continuous learning, improvement, and ultimately, greater success.
  7. The Art of Listening: Arrogant individuals tend to dominate conversations, dismissing the opinions and perspectives of others. This closed-mindedness stifles innovation and limits personal growth. Conversely, by practicing active listening and valuing diverse viewpoints, we create an environment that fosters collaboration, creativity, and a rich exchange of ideas.
  8. The Loneliness of the Narcissist: Narcissism, fueled by arrogance and ego, creates an illusion of superiority. However, behind the facade lies an inner emptiness and a profound sense of loneliness. Genuine connections and meaningful relationships are sacrificed for self-aggrandizement, leaving the narcissist isolated and craving the authentic human connection they’ve neglected.
